Output 95e8206264a737a69ef516ca676e2dc1726c1a754b925202416a96b0a9593c03:1

value
669500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9cdb4ac11efe911974b01359fc99db93f0472c32 OP_EQUAL
address
3FzQ39NnBpHFZ3pHLUvARRipufdYpvEtRk
transaction
95e8206264a737a69ef516ca676e2dc1726c1a754b925202416a96b0a9593c03
spent
true